Output e57662d61db0141eddb203b23ccdc327ff33e81c52cdb311ea2c30946bed16db:0

value
108437
script pubkey
OP_0 OP_PUSHBYTES_20 1f3d9c9dee29c89ce465516472030a53e5e0ed61
address
bc1qru7ee80w98yfeer929j8yqc220j7pmtpseal2a
transaction
e57662d61db0141eddb203b23ccdc327ff33e81c52cdb311ea2c30946bed16db
confirmations
301777
spent
true